How Does The MaxiPod® Work?
MaxiPod® Thermal Storage Systems work by reversing the function of the Primary (Heating) and Secondary (Domestic) waters.
The Primary water is stored in the cylinder and heated by a boiler or renewables. When heated by a boiler, the water can also be pumped from the thermal store around your heating system, to provide space heating.
Fast, Efficient Hot Water
The secondary water comes directly from the mains or pumped cold water storage and passes through a specially designed heat exchanger, which draws heat from the MaxiPod® thermal store.
This water then passes through a thermostatic mixing valve, which blends it to the correct temperature before providing fresh drinkable hot and cold water straight to your taps. This constantly moving water does not allow legionella harbouring bacteria to grow and means your water is always safe!

Why Choose Copper?
Our copper cylinders use only recycled copper. Recycled copper meets 42% of the European copper demand. It requires only 15% of the energy for extracting new raw materials, making it sustainable, environmentally friendly and the most recycled plumbing material available today.
Copper also has a long and established history of being used in conveying clean, safe drinking water. It boasts natural antibacterial properties and inherent health benefits making it a well trusted, tried and tested material for water supply and storage. The presence of copper ions destroys potential Legionella harbouring bacteria responsible for Legionnaires’ disease, making your water clean and safe to drink.
